The journey from Wollongbar to Griffith spans roughly 1000 kilometers across the heart of New South Wales. You will traverse the Great Dividing Range before descending into the fertile plains of the Riverina region. Driving is the most common method, utilizing the Newell Highway as the primary artery. Alternatively, you can fly from Ballina to Sydney and connect to Griffith Airport. This route takes you through major agricultural hubs and historic country towns.

Total Distance: 1050 km driving distance, 820 km straight-line air distance.

Safety Tips
  • Fatigue
    Take a 15-minute break every two hours to maintain alertness.
  • Road Conditions
    Be aware of road trains on the Newell Highway; keep a safe distance when overtaking.
  • Emergency
    Keep a physical road atlas in your car as a backup to GPS.
  • Wildlife
    Be extra cautious at dawn and dusk when kangaroos are most active near the roadside.

Things to Do in Griffith
1
Hermit's Cave
Explore the historic cave dwellings on Scenic Hill. They offer a unique glimpse into the life of a local recluse and provide great views.
2
Griffith Regional Art Gallery
Visit this gallery to see a rotating collection of contemporary Australian art. It is a cultural highlight of the Riverina region.
3
Catania Fruit Salad Farm
Take a guided tour of this working farm to learn about the region's diverse agricultural production. It is a family-friendly experience.
4
De Bortoli Wines
Sample world-class wines at this iconic winery. The cellar door offers tastings and a beautiful garden setting.
